@fes0r "свой простенький тип" - имеется ввиду свой mapping type? Тогда уточняющий вопрос еще актуален: А если у того объекта есть зависимости, которые также должны быть воссо...
Ребят. Тут я питон начал изучать. Смотрю что нет none-aware оператора до сих пор https://www.python.org/dev/peps/pep-0505/ Как вы живете без этого? Я про то, как в real-world...
Изучаю Doctrine. 1) Что если я хочу хранить сериализовать свойство объекта в json, а при извлечении из бд развернуть в объектное представление обратно? Custom mapping type? ...
О, тогда накину. Недавно кто-то писал что несколько интерфейсов у класса нарушает SRP. Кто согласен, а кто нет? Почему?
Играюсь с типизированными свойствами PHP 7.4 Есть идеи как сделать ленивую инициализацию типизированного свойства? https://pastebin.com/b55UvgQj
Встречал ли кто инструмент/либу для кастомной query language? По типу Jira Query Language для advanced запросов к данным от пользователей
По примеру 1. Какая может быть причина для изменения? Должна ли она обязательно одновременно затрагивать 2 метода encrypt/decrypt?
и еще по Примеру 1. Что нам дает разделение интерфейса на 2 здесь, вместо одного, с двумя публичными методами?
@vudaltsov , обязательно начни с вопроса: “что такое статическая типизация?” 😂
одна обязанность/зона ответсвенности - это одна причина для изменения?
Как заставить шторм не ругаться на отсутствие docblocks только в случае если хинты есть?
его ж только недавно апрувнули. Кстати, есть у кого php-cs-fixer ruleset для psr 12?
В процентах на сколько? Потому что я ещё не закончил рефакторинг)
@fes0r , ты на php fwdays планируешь в спикеры?
SimpleXMLElement - нарушает SRP?
2 интерфейса - это 2 обязанности?
кстати, как вам синтаксис атрибутов?
есть что еще полезного в ISP?
Так а чего топикстартер не комментирует?) Сразу в РО?
postgres/mysql json ?)